In addition to obtaining a PWD, employers must conduct recruitment to test the U.S. labor market for able, willing, qualified, and available U.S. workers for the sponsored job opportunity. The NPWC issues PWDs based on multiple factors, including, but not limited to, the job title, job description, minimum requirements for the position, and the area of intended employment. To complete the PERM process, employers must submit a request for a Prevailing Wage Determination (PWD), run a recruitment campaign, and file a PERM with the DOL for certification. As part of the PERM Labor Certification (PERM) process, an employer must obtain a Prevailing Wage Determination (PWD) from the Department of Labors (DOL) National Prevailing Wage Center (NPWC).
